Summer Camps in Carson City, NV Metropolitan Area

The end of the school year will be here before you know it. If you live in the Carson City, NV Metropolitan Area, or near Eagle Valley town, you can sign your child up for an awesome summer camp. No matter what their interests are, you can find something they will enjoy.

Sign your child up for a summer camp. Why not let them learn how to ride a horse? Nevada has ranches that specialize in horseback riding. Very few other states offer this type of camping opportunity. At a horseback riding camp, staff will review safety procedures before your child can ride. Campers will experience riding on a trail under the watchful eye of a tour guide. The cost will vary so it’s best to check with several ranches.

If your child is active, select a camp that allows them to move their body. Check with dance studios for a martial arts camp or a dance camp. Children can learn ballet, tap, jazz, hip hop and other dances. The cost for these programs can vary between $20.00 and $50.00.

Kids Create! Session I: August 1 – 5, 2016 Session II: August 8 – 12, 2016 Ages 5 to 12 | commuter only | online application deadline: July 1, 2016 Fill your childs summer days with music, dance, theater, and visual arts. Children develop their imaginations and skills through drawing, painting, collage, movement, music, improvisational theater, creative dramatics, and playwriting. Classes are taught by professional musicians and artists from Rutgers Universitys Mason Gross School of the Arts. Each weeks offerings are unique, so children may participate in one or both weeks. Camp weeks end with showcases, giving students the opportunity to perform for their families. No prior experience needed. KODA Youth Girls (Ages 13–16) - Camp Mark 7
Camp Mark Seven offers a place where hearing children of Deaf parents could come together to learn about, and better understand the two worlds that they simultaneously live in, and where they could explore, identify, and strengthen their unique C/KODA identities and develop individually as leaders. All of this would occur, ideally, in a recreational camping environment that would foster a lot of interaction and activities for each child and youth. Program activities: Swimming and tubing. Paddle a canoe on the chosen rivers/lakes and camp out under the stars. Low ropes course. Diverse outdoor games. Arts & crafts. Hike different mountains. Evening Bonfires. Shopping in Old Forge and Inlet. Campers will create skits for Parents Night; Parents Night is offered at the end of the program, and family members are invited to come and watch their childs skits.
